What Is Snap-8?
Snap-8 is a synthetic peptide derived from the N-terminal end of SNAP-25, a protein involved in the SNARE complex responsible for neurotransmitter release at nerve endings.
Researchers study Snap-8 because of its apparent ability to interfere with signalling pathways associated with facial muscle contraction.
This has made it one of the most recognised peptides in cosmetic anti-wrinkle and expression-line research.

SNARE Complex Interaction
One of the major areas of Snap-8 research involves its interaction with the SNARE complex — a protein system involved in neurotransmitter release.
Researchers investigate whether Snap-8 may:
Compete with SNAP-25 activity
Influence neurotransmitter release pathways
Reduce contraction-related signalling
Alter repetitive facial muscle activity
This mechanism is central to its growing popularity in cosmetic peptide science.
